Personalized Shopping Experiences

Advanced cart tech is now capable of providing highly personalized shopping experiences to users. By analyzing a customer's browsing and purchase history, the technology can suggest products that they are more likely to be interested in, thereby increasing the chances of a sale.

  • Product Recommendations: Intelligent algorithms suggest items based on customer preferences.
  • Tailored Discounts: Offering personalized promotions to incentivize purchases.

Seamless Checkout Process

A streamlined checkout process is critical in reducing cart abandonment rates. Modern cart tech simplifies this process through various means:

  • One-Page Checkout: Reducing the number of steps to complete a purchase.
  • Autocomplete Address Fields: Integrating with services like Google Maps for quick address filling.
  • Multiple Payment Options: Incorporating various payment gateways and digital wallets.

Enhanced Security Measures

Trust is paramount in e-commerce. Shoppers need to feel confident that their personal and payment information is secure.

  • SSL Certificates: Encrypting data to protect customer information during transactions.
  • Payment Card Industry (PCI) Compliance: Adhering to standards for a secure payment environment.
  • Two-Factor Authentication: Adding an extra layer of security at checkout.

Mobile Optimization

With mobile commerce on the rise, ensuring your shopping cart is optimized for mobile devices is essential.

  • Responsive Design: Ensuring the cart and checkout process adjusts to all screen sizes.
  • Mobile-First Approach: Prioritizing mobile users in the design and functionality of the cart.

Abandoned Cart Recovery

Sometimes, customers leave items in their carts without completing the purchase. Advanced cart technology can help recover these sales.

  • Automated Email Reminders: Sending timely emails to remind customers of their abandoned carts.
  • Exit-Intent Popups: Displaying a message or offer to retain customers about to leave the site.

Real-Time Analytics

To continually refine the shopping cart experience, real-time analytics play a significant role in understanding user behavior and conversion funnels.

  • User Behavior Tracking: Monitoring actions taken within the cart to identify patterns.
  • Conversion Optimization: Applying A/B testing to improve the effectiveness of the cart and checkout pages.

Social Proof and Reviews

The inclusion of social proof such as customer reviews and ratings within the cart can reassure potential buyers about the quality of your products.

  • Embedded Reviews: Showcasing customer feedback directly on the cart page.
  • Trust Badges: Displaying endorsements or certifications to build credibility.

Inventory Management Integration

Keeping track of inventory is important to prevent overselling and disappointing customers. Cart tech can be integrated with inventory management systems to update product availability in real time.

  • Real-Time Stock Updates: Automatically refreshing inventory counts as purchases are made.
  • Backorder Notifications: Informing customers when an item is out of stock and expected availability.
